Foros del Web » Programando para Internet » Javascript »

Buscar un id dentro de una capa

Estas en el tema de Buscar un id dentro de una capa en el foro de Javascript en Foros del Web. Hola q tal despues de mucho intentar y buscar recurro a ustedes. Bueno mi problema es que necesito buscar un id en especifico dentro de ...
  #1 (permalink)  
Antiguo 05/06/2009, 20:19
Avatar de acoevil  
Fecha de Ingreso: julio-2008
Ubicación: localhost/colombia/sevillaValle.php
Mensajes: 1.123
Antigüedad: 15 años, 9 meses
Puntos: 32
Pregunta Buscar un id dentro de una capa

Hola q tal despues de mucho intentar y buscar recurro a ustedes.

Bueno mi problema es que necesito buscar un id en especifico dentro de una capa llamada capa_agrega por ejemplo tengo esto.

<div id="capa_agrega"><div id="buscar"></div></div>

Necesito que saber si dentro de capa_agrega hay una capa llamada buscar, se q lo puedo hacer utilizando el metodo getElementById.
  #2 (permalink)  
Antiguo 05/06/2009, 21:38
Avatar de Panino5001
Me alejo de Omelas
 
Fecha de Ingreso: mayo-2004
Ubicación: -34.637167,-58.462984
Mensajes: 5.148
Antigüedad: 20 años
Puntos: 834
Respuesta: Buscar un id dentro de una capa

Probá así:
Código PHP:
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<
html xmlns="http://www.w3.org/1999/xhtml">
<
head>
<
me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1" />
<
title>Documento sin t&iacute;tulo</title>
<
script>
function 
verificar(contenedorId,idObj){
    if(!
document.getElementById(idObj) || !document.getElementById(contenedorId))
        return 
false;
    return 
document.getElementById(idObj).parentNode==document.getElementById(contenedorId);
}
onload=function(){alert(verificar("capa_agrega","buscar"));}
</script>
</head>

<body>
<div id="capa_agrega"><div id="buscar"></div></div>
</body>
</html> 
  #3 (permalink)  
Antiguo 05/06/2009, 22:28
Avatar de acoevil  
Fecha de Ingreso: julio-2008
Ubicación: localhost/colombia/sevillaValle.php
Mensajes: 1.123
Antigüedad: 15 años, 9 meses
Puntos: 32
Respuesta: Buscar un id dentro de una capa

Q tal lo termine resolviendo asi muchas gracias

function existenciaDiv2(primero){
//Comprueba que en el div2 no exista un formulario con el mismo nombre
// del que se esta creando
//5
var capa_agrega=document.getElementById("capa_agrega") ;
var cantidad=capa_agrega.childNodes.length;
for(var n=0;n<cantidad;n++){
if(capa_agrega.childNodes[n].id==primero){
return true;
}
}
return false;

}
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 21:40.